The U.S. Supreme Court has agreed to hear a dispute over seizure of lands controlled by New Jersey for construction of the proposed PennEast Pipeline.

An unknown factor in the high-stakes case is whether the Biden administration’s approach to the case will differ from the pro-pipeline stance of the federal government under the Trump administration. On the day he was inaugurated, Biden signed an order revoking a permit for the Keystone XL pipeline running between Canada and Texas.
